Output fa5c073d823a64b5b421fd631d901aa5434a9cee0b137c0899b02d6e1b199e7d:0

value
1352623808
script pubkey
OP_0 OP_PUSHBYTES_20 51bb588ebe6f13c26a1f03cf279a724b55823023
address
tb1q2xa43r47dufuy6slq08j0xnjfd2cyvpraf4dsw
transaction
fa5c073d823a64b5b421fd631d901aa5434a9cee0b137c0899b02d6e1b199e7d